## Service Accounts — Tillhaven Autocomplete Widget

The address autocomplete widget runs under the svc-tillhaven-lookup account. This account has read-only access to the gazetteer index and nothing else. Do not reuse it for geocoding batch jobs; those have their own account. Rotation happens every 120 days via the secrets pipeline; maintainers only need to act if rotation fails two cycles in a row. For local testing against the staging index, use the service key below.

gateway credential: kto23_LX9A4ys6i4nzHtpOLNLodKK

Hi support folks,

Heads up: Thursday's DR drill at Cartmoor will briefly disable the Fleetline driver-assignment heuristic, so drivers get matched round-robin for about an hour. Expect a few confused tickets — just tag them DRILL. If the failover console asks you to re-authenticate mid-drill, use the recovery passphrase below.

unlock words, tawif-tahop: oliys-ulawyn-tamdor-lamys-casox-jormir-fraius-kasath-ulador-ulamir-holir-sorys-holeth

Step 6: Cutting over Ledgepath API pagination.

For the sync: the public REST API moves from offset to cursor pagination this release. Deploy the compatibility shim first so old clients keep working, then flip the cursor flag per region, watching the malformed-request dashboard between each. Responses now include an opaque next-page token, which is signed server-side to prevent tampering. Verification requires the current signing key, reproduced below.

rollout seal: bky4_x7Gc